## Onboarding: Farebranch Rules Engine

Plugin authors integrate with Farebranch by registering fee rules against the evaluation API. Rules are sandboxed; they cannot perform network calls directly. All rate-table lookups go through the host, which validates your plugin manifest at load time. Your local env file must include the signing credential the host uses to verify manifests, set on the next line.

secret setting of bajef-fajof: COURIER_KEY3=76c

Minutes — Management Meeting, Warranty Cost Overrun

Present: G. Marrow, F. Selt, A. Quintrell. Warranty spend on the Vantrex unit ran 22% over plan, traced to a seal defect from the Aldenmoor facility. Supplier claim filed; recovery uncertain. Sales leads to pause extended-warranty promotions pending review. Next update in two weeks. Note the confidential item recorded below these minutes.

board note of bawep-tajef: Queniusek Systems plans to raise the Quenvan list price by 53.1 percent in March. The pricing group signed off on a budget of $176.4 million for Project Drueth. The renewal with Casionix Partners closes at $142.5 million a year, 8.3 percent below the last contract. Project Fraax slips by six weeks because of the tooling delay.

## Who owns this thing?

The Murmurcast feed validator core is maintained in-house; plugins are all yours. If your plugin trips a validation rule that seems wrong, or you need a new hook exposed, don't guess — open an issue first. For API questions and review requests, reach out to the maintainer listed below.

named custodian: Zorwyn Kaswyn Jorath Aldok

The Ardvale fleet fuel-usage report aggregates roughly 1.4M telemetry rows nightly, and runtime has grown 11% month over month. To keep it inside the maintenance window, we partition by depot and cap per-partition memory, spilling to disk past the threshold. The constants governing partition size, memory ceilings, and spill behavior follow.

tuning table, yajog-yahof:
BUDGETS = {
    "lamvan": 303,
    "wenox": 460,
    "fenvan": 525,
}